The Play Timer: A Game-Changer for Time Management

Losing awareness of time is one of the largest hidden risks in online casino play. CasinOK’s session timer allows you to set a maximum continuous play window, after which a reality check appears and requests you to confirm you want to carry on. We established a 60-minute maximum, about the length of a show or a hockey game. In the opening week, the notification came up while we were playing slots. We were shocked to see that what seemed like 20 minutes had in fact been a full hour. The disparity between sensed and actual time is well understood, but experiencing it firsthand was sobering. After the notification, we could carry on playing or sign out; we chose to keep going only four times during the full test. The timer functioned as a light tap on the shoulder, not a reprimand. Our average session time decreased from about 90 minutes to just over 55 minutes, without cutting into the fun. It erased the accidental overtime that had been consuming our time.

Loss Boundaries: Halting While We Were Losing

While deposit limits governed money going into our account, loss limits controlled what happened once play started. We configured a daily net loss limit of $75, which meant that once our balance fell by that amount from the session peak, the platform would stop further bets. The very first time we encountered that wall, we were in the middle of a blackjack session that had turned sour. In earlier months, without the tool, we would have chucked more money at the table to recover the loss. Instead, a clear screen appeared telling us we’d reached our self-imposed limit. It seemed jarring but liberating. Over the trial, we triggered the loss limit 14 times. We tracked our mood right after each incident and found that frustration melted away within minutes, substituted by relief that our grocery money was still intact. The shift changed a potential regret into a non-event.

Time-Out Intervals and Self-Exclusion Options

In addition to daily thresholds, CasinOK provides time-out breaks from 24 hours to six weeks, along with a voluntary exclusion choice for longer breaks. We evaluated a 72-hour cooling-off after a intensive weekend. To trigger it, we had to confirm by email, which blocked an impulsive decision. When we tried to log in during that window, the platform showed a neutral break reminder. No criticism, just a locked door. Over those three days, we exchanged casino time for reading and walks, and the restorative effect on our mood was clear. The self-exclusion feature, though we didn’t need it indefinitely, seemed to align closely with Ontario’s regulations. Knowing a firm escape hatch was there reduced the background anxiety that sometimes tags along online play. We began to see these pauses not as punishments, but as timely pit stops that let us enjoy the drive more.

Is it possible to change my deposit limit immediately if I want to increase it?

No, if you want to raise a deposit cap, you have to wait through a 24-hour cooling-off period. This delay is designed to stop impulsive decisions taken in an emotional moment. If you decide to lower a limit, the change kicks in straight away, giving you extra protection at once. The system is built to make tightening easy and loosening harder, so a moment of annoyance or excitement is unable to override your long-term plans.
